Overview of 4J36 expansion alloy The Curie point of 4J36 expansion alloy is about 230 ° C. Below this temperature, the alloy is ferromagnetic and has a very low expansion coefficient. Above this temperature, the alloy is non-magnetic, and the expansion coefficient increases. big.

The alloy is mainly used to manufacture components with approximately constant dimensions in the range of temperature changes, and is widely used in the radio industry, precision instruments, meters and other industries. 4J36 This alloy is a typical low expansion alloy. After long-term use in aviation factories, the performance is stable; the heat treatment process and processing technology should be strictly controlled in use to ensure the stability of the material.

4J36 parts treatment process The alloy heat treatment can be divided into: stress relief annealing, intermediate annealing and stabilization treatment.

(1) Stress relief annealing In order to eliminate the residual stress of the parts after machining, stress relief annealing should be carried out: 530 ~ 550 ºC, heat preservation for 1 ~ 2h, furnace cooling.

(2) Intermediate annealing is to eliminate the work hardening phenomenon caused by the cold rolling, cold drawing and cold stamping process of the alloy, so as to facilitate continued processing. The workpiece is heated to 830 ~ 880 ºC, kept for 30 minutes, furnace cooling or air cooling.

(3) Stabilization treatment is a treatment that has a lower expansion coefficient and can stabilize its performance. Generally, three-stage processing is used.

a) Homogenization: During heating, the impurities in the alloy are fully dissolved and the alloying elements tend to be uniform. The workpiece is heated to 830 ° C in a protective atmosphere, kept for 20 min to 1 h, and then quenched.

b) Tempering: The stress caused by quenching can be partially eliminated during the tempering process. The workpiece is heated to 315°C, kept for 1 to 4 hours, and cooled in the furnace.

c) Stabilization aging: to stabilize the size of the alloy. The workpiece is heated to 95ºC and kept for 48h.

For high-precision parts after cold working or machining, when high temperature treatment is not suitable, the following stress relief and stabilization treatment can be used: the workpiece is heated to 315 ~ 370 ºC for 1 ~ 4h. This alloy cannot be hardened by heat treatment.

4J36 Surface treatment process: The surface treatment can be sandblasted, polished or pickled.

The alloy can be pickled with 25% hydrochloric acid solution at 70ºC to remove the oxide scale. At 4000A/m, the residual magnetic induction intensity Br=0.6T, and the coercive force Hc=48A/m[1,2].
